AP Psychology Motivation Unit

This AP Psychology Motivation Unit plan encompasses a comprehensive exploration of motivation theories, biological and cognitive influences, and practical applications. Students begin by learning about major motivational theories. In the second lesson, they delve into how these theories intersect with biological and cognitive factors. Finally, they apply and critically evaluate these theories through case studies and real-life examples, enhancing their understanding and ability to use the concepts in varied contexts.
